Michelle de Bonneuil

French overseas agent during the French Revolution

Michelle de Bonneuil

Summary

Michelle de Bonneuil is a human[1]. She was born in Sainte-Suzanne[2]. She was born on March 7, 1748[3]. She died in Paris[4]. She died on December 30, 1829[5]. She worked as a spy[6].

Personal Life

Children include Laure Regnaud de Saint-Jean d'Angély[8], a salonnière[21], 1776–1857[22] and Amédée Despans-Cubières[9], a politician[23], 1786–1853[24], of France[25], awarded the Grand Officer of the Legion of Honour[26].
